📄 esrigeodatabase.tlh
字号:
// Created by Microsoft (R) C/C++ Compiler Version 12.00.8168.0 (9878b5fc).
//
// esriGeoDatabase.tlh
//
// C++ source equivalent of Win32 type library c:/Program Files/ArcGis/com/esriGeoDatabase.olb
// compiler-generated file created 08/02/06 at 09:01:55 - DO NOT EDIT!
//
// Cross-referenced type libraries:
//
// #import "C:\Program Files\ArcGIS\com\esriSystem.olb"
// #import "C:\Program Files\ArcGIS\com\esriGeometry.olb"
// #import "C:\Program Files\ArcGIS\com\esriDisplay.olb"
//
#pragma once
#pragma pack(push, 8)
#include <comdef.h>
//
// Forward references and typedefs
//
struct __declspec(uuid("c2697cbc-3d8a-4888-ae34-5c35180181a6"))
/* interface */ IGeoDBProtectNames;
struct __declspec(uuid("d4803ee1-79f4-11d0-97fc-0080c7f79481"))
/* interface */ IWorkspace;
struct __declspec(uuid("f173fc16-d63a-11d1-aa81-00c04fa33a15"))
/* interface */ IWorkspaceFactory;
struct __declspec(uuid("fadd975c-e36f-11d1-aa81-00c04fa33a15"))
/* interface */ IWorkspaceName;
struct __declspec(uuid("2d04c044-7766-11d0-b77d-00805f7ced21"))
/* interface */ IEnumDataset;
struct __declspec(uuid("2d04c042-7766-11d0-b77d-00805f7ced21"))
/* interface */ IDataset;
struct __declspec(uuid("89e75919-c287-11d1-aa77-00c04fa33a15"))
/* interface */ IEnumDatasetName;
struct __declspec(uuid("89e75917-c287-11d1-aa77-00c04fa33a15"))
/* interface */ IDatasetName;
struct __declspec(uuid("ab4a2d79-055b-11d2-aa97-00c04fa33a15"))
/* interface */ IRemoteDatabaseWorkspace;
struct __declspec(uuid("8d39a5ff-bdc8-11d0-87f8-080009ec732a"))
/* interface */ IEnumWorkspace;
struct __declspec(uuid("ab4a2d7a-055b-11d2-aa97-00c04fa33a15"))
/* interface */ IRemoteDatabaseWorkspaceFactory;
struct __declspec(uuid("a867a185-c5cb-11d2-aae2-00c04fa37849"))
/* interface */ ISQLPrivilege;
struct __declspec(uuid("34c20004-4d3c-11d0-92d8-00805f7c28b0"))
/* interface */ IGeoDataset;
struct __declspec(uuid("40a9e882-5533-11d0-98be-00805f7ced21"))
/* interface */ IProperty;
struct __declspec(uuid("40a9e881-5533-11d0-98be-00805f7ced21"))
/* interface */ IEnumProperty;
struct __declspec(uuid("234c31c1-9740-11d1-89e2-006097aff44e"))
/* interface */ IDatasetEditInfo;
struct __declspec(uuid("448c5d21-9746-11d1-89e2-006097aff44e"))
/* interface */ IDatasetEdit;
struct __declspec(uuid("f05d9bc1-d03c-11d1-887f-0000f877762d"))
/* interface */ ITransactions;
struct __declspec(uuid("6e45153f-df82-11d1-aa82-00c04fa37585"))
/* interface */ ITransactionsOptions;
struct __declspec(uuid("1b256191-b380-11d1-9ce6-0000f8780619"))
/* interface */ IVersionedWorkspace;
struct __declspec(uuid("c0d27014-d933-11d1-aa7d-00c04fa37585"))
/* interface */ IEnumVersionInfo;
struct __declspec(uuid("904c01cf-0ed9-11d3-9f3e-00c04f6bddd9"))
/* interface */ IVersionInfo;
struct __declspec(uuid("1a945841-b381-11d1-9ce6-0000f8780619"))
/* interface */ IVersion;
struct __declspec(uuid("0f2e4f13-93b2-11d3-9f62-00c04f6bddd9"))
/* interface */ IEnumLockInfo;
struct __declspec(uuid("751ad693-93b2-11d3-9f62-00c04f6bddd9"))
/* interface */ ILockInfo;
struct __declspec(uuid("4a1fb361-b863-11d1-9ce7-0000f8780619"))
/* interface */ IVersionedObject;
struct __declspec(uuid("5de04a82-24e4-11d3-a641-0008c7d3ae50"))
/* interface */ IMetadata;
struct __declspec(uuid("97fdb978-62a4-49c5-8252-b07837b33ee9"))
/* interface */ IMetadataEdit;
struct __declspec(uuid("18e2854e-edc8-11d2-aaef-00c04fa37849"))
/* interface */ ISQLSyntax;
struct __declspec(uuid("dca648e5-0fbb-11d3-80a5-00c04f686238"))
/* interface */ ISchemaLock;
struct __declspec(uuid("a67958d7-226e-11d3-80b2-00c04f686238"))
/* interface */ IEnumSchemaLockInfo;
struct __declspec(uuid("a67958d8-226e-11d3-80b2-00c04f686238"))
/* interface */ ISchemaLockInfo;
struct __declspec(uuid("4b21005e-01df-4945-9038-adcbd17a0f2e"))
/* interface */ IWorkspace2;
struct __declspec(uuid("2808cad6-e0fa-4478-be5b-0e645a2bc7ed"))
/* interface */ IDatabaseConnectionInfo;
struct __declspec(uuid("7771b899-02cd-46d1-aae1-5392b662c8d0"))
/* interface */ IWorkspaceProperty;
struct __declspec(uuid("0f1b2257-e2d8-4046-b749-7ff1b058a943"))
/* interface */ IWorkspaceProperties;
struct __declspec(uuid("da10c1bd-09a3-11d4-9faa-00c04f6bdf0c"))
/* interface */ IWorkspaceHelper;
struct __declspec(uuid("da10c1c0-09a3-11d4-9faa-00c04f6bdf0c"))
/* interface */ IWorkspaceExtensionControl;
struct __declspec(uuid("da10c1c2-09a3-11d4-9faa-00c04f6bdf0c"))
/* interface */ IWorkspaceExtension;
struct __declspec(uuid("b2119283-0cd1-11d4-9fac-00c04f6bdf0c"))
/* interface */ IWorkspaceExtensionManager;
struct __declspec(uuid("da10c1c4-09a3-11d4-9faa-00c04f6bdf0c"))
/* interface */ IWorkspaceEvents;
struct __declspec(uuid("05fc30e9-3007-11d4-8140-00c04f686238"))
/* interface */ IWorkspaceName2;
struct __declspec(uuid("d29cd15f-3014-11d4-8141-00c04f686238"))
/* interface */ IWorkspaceFactory2;
struct __declspec(uuid("bbe342c6-2618-4540-95b5-d6a82f618dfa"))
/* interface */ IWorkspaceStatus;
struct __declspec(uuid("c2608adb-10a1-4d0c-aba6-5975f6d9c1df"))
/* interface */ IEnumWorkspaceStatus;
struct __declspec(uuid("9b90c0b4-6848-4a17-a0a4-708ee05193d6"))
/* interface */ IWorkspaceFactoryStatus;
struct __declspec(uuid("9ea6f82b-80ae-4702-9906-2c90ac40c227"))
/* interface */ IWorkspaceFactoryFileExtensions;
struct __declspec(uuid("06dc8e4b-951c-11d2-ae75-080009ec732a"))
/* interface */ IScratchWorkspaceFactory;
struct __declspec(uuid("ceb80992-ebc0-482b-9cd9-9974ab40d4c2"))
/* interface */ IScratchWorkspaceFactory2;
struct __declspec(uuid("968ab1ea-7c1f-4aa1-9055-ca98cb622278"))
/* interface */ IWorkspaceFactorySchemaCache;
struct __declspec(uuid("4e3a0d23-6213-4b78-9a2f-b9286d34e3d3"))
/* interface */ IWorkspaceProgressTracker;
struct __declspec(uuid("60e8162b-1ae0-11d4-9fb1-00c04f6bdf0c"))
/* interface */ IDatasetEditEx;
struct __declspec(uuid("52d4a757-df71-47e0-aab8-ee302eb7acab"))
/* interface */ IDatasetFileStat;
struct __declspec(uuid("9db4594f-dc4b-457a-ae2e-ffea8bd8d72e"))
/* interface */ IDatasetNameFileStat;
struct __declspec(uuid("62ae7f20-59e5-44af-8dba-fa4da33b6af7"))
/* interface */ IDatasetNameFileSize;
struct __declspec(uuid("995d5c91-15c6-11d2-89ed-006097aff44e"))
/* interface */ IWorkspaceEditInfo;
struct __declspec(uuid("995d5c92-15c6-11d2-89ed-006097aff44e"))
/* interface */ IWorkspaceEdit;
struct __declspec(uuid("17240108-a1c0-4f02-bb9a-35d970abee15"))
/* interface */ IWorkspaceEditControl;
struct __declspec(uuid("0b437962-89f9-11d4-8b5f-000000000000"))
/* interface */ IWorkspaceEditEvents;
struct __declspec(uuid("e2e4622f-55b4-11d3-9f77-00c04f6bdf0c"))
/* interface */ ISpatialCacheManager;
struct __declspec(uuid("9078f181-bb75-11d4-9feb-00c04f6bdf0c"))
/* interface */ ISpatialCacheManager2;
struct __declspec(uuid("74d077b7-4f42-439d-8aca-2433cbd15916"))
/* interface */ ISpatialCacheManager3;
struct __declspec(uuid("6b267c02-28cc-11d3-9f67-00c04f6bdf0c"))
/* interface */ IGeoDatasetSchemaEdit;
struct __declspec(uuid("9d039f1b-8b1e-494d-81b1-c6b6ae7c167a"))
/* interface */ IVersionedWorkspace2;
struct __declspec(uuid("884d388e-8918-443a-8f4a-db5aac5b9d5e"))
/* interface */ IVersionedObject2;
struct __declspec(uuid("adf6d66d-a47a-11d4-9f87-00c04f6bdf0e"))
/* interface */ IFileDataLock;
struct __declspec(uuid("660214d1-7c1b-11d3-80ea-00c04f686238"))
/* interface */ IDatabaseCompact;
struct __declspec(uuid("516c0a6d-8021-11d3-80eb-00c04f686238"))
/* interface */ ILocalDatabaseCompact;
struct __declspec(uuid("094a1c7d-90ae-11d3-80ef-00c04f686238"))
/* interface */ ISetDefaultConnectionInfo;
struct __declspec(uuid("518570d2-ef66-4b3b-b0bb-fcac077814df"))
/* interface */ ISetDefaultConnectionInfo2;
struct __declspec(uuid("bdc57556-f689-4149-a526-b49dea3f443f"))
/* interface */ INativeType;
struct __declspec(uuid("12b123e8-895d-4d2f-a7b0-c7c07cf195e0"))
/* interface */ INativeTypeSearch;
struct __declspec(uuid("906db24a-f0ad-4ca5-871b-5466e54fab80"))
/* interface */ INativeTypeInfo;
struct __declspec(uuid("d425f87a-5b3a-4200-a050-380084cbedf0"))
/* interface */ IComplexNativeType;
struct /* coclass */ WorkspaceHelper;
struct __declspec(uuid("36a4d970-f5d5-11d3-8120-00c04f686238"))
/* interface */ IEnumNameMapping;
struct __declspec(uuid("36a4d96f-f5d5-11d3-8120-00c04f686238"))
/* interface */ INameMapping;
struct __declspec(uuid("d4e6badf-3eb9-4f4e-9103-c7d0cbc119a2"))
/* interface */ INameMapping2;
struct __declspec(uuid("5f345e5f-4251-11d4-8145-00c04f686238"))
/* interface */ IEnumSpatialReferenceInfo;
struct __declspec(uuid("89890719-42d8-11d4-8145-00c04f686238"))
/* interface */ IWorkspaceSpatialReferenceInfo;
struct __declspec(uuid("2be5da4c-7a75-4cc9-aa73-c0320b89846f"))
/* interface */ IConfigurationKeyword;
struct __declspec(uuid("75b1cca3-ee77-4a5f-8fcd-1775d6f9497b"))
/* interface */ IEnumConfigurationParameter;
struct __declspec(uuid("32bd0a83-25e5-4f24-b81b-5ebea2dfe35a"))
/* interface */ IConfigurationParameter;
struct __declspec(uuid("b055bbd8-de08-49cd-a589-fffd22112cd5"))
/* interface */ IEnumConfigurationKeyword;
struct __declspec(uuid("9e8f5c35-7888-4df9-862c-9dd74eff9062"))
/* interface */ IWorkspaceConfiguration;
struct /* coclass */ WorkspaceProperty;
struct /* coclass */ WorkspaceEditEvents;
struct /* coclass */ Workspace;
struct __declspec(uuid("bd770969-efb7-11d3-9fa2-00c04f6bdf0c"))
/* interface */ IDatasetContainer;
struct __declspec(uuid("d9cab491-3f69-11d1-b095-0000f8780820"))
/* interface */ IFeatureWorkspace;
struct __declspec(uuid("fcb01cb5-9f0b-11d0-bec7-00805f7c4268"))
/* interface */ ITable;
struct __declspec(uuid("1afcdb32-ac09-11d2-8a1e-006097aff44e"))
/* interface */ IClass;
struct __declspec(uuid("6b2072e3-23f7-11d1-89d8-006097aff44e"))
/* interface */ IFields;
struct __declspec(uuid("fcb01cb3-9f0b-11d0-bec7-00805f7c4268"))
/* interface */ IField;
struct __declspec(uuid("df18fe0a-84ba-11d2-ab61-000000000000"))
/* interface */ IDomain;
struct __declspec(uuid("439a0d50-3915-11d1-9ca7-0000f8780619"))
/* interface */ IGeometryDef;
struct __declspec(uuid("2063fd03-4ce0-11d1-89db-006097aff44e"))
/* interface */ IIndexes;
struct __declspec(uuid("2063fd01-4ce0-11d1-89db-006097aff44e"))
/* interface */ IIndex;
struct __declspec(uuid("23bd2b49-bf8b-11d2-aadd-00c04fa37849"))
/* interface */ IEnumIndex;
struct __declspec(uuid("fcb01cb4-9f0b-11d0-bec7-00805f7c4268"))
/* interface */ IRow;
struct __declspec(uuid("93684651-1a83-11d1-8802-0000f877762d"))
/* interface */ IRowBuffer;
struct __declspec(uuid("d4803ee7-79f4-11d0-97fc-0080c7f79481"))
/* interface */ ICursor;
struct __declspec(uuid("fdfebd93-ed75-11d0-9a95-080009ec734b"))
/* interface */ IQueryFilter;
struct __declspec(uuid("f7ad47d1-d55e-11d1-8882-0000f877762d"))
/* interface */ ISelectionSet;
struct __declspec(uuid("7d84b001-1521-11d2-89ed-006097aff44e"))
/* interface */ IEnumIDs;
struct __declspec(uuid("d4803ee6-79f4-11d0-97fc-0080c7f79481"))
/* interface */ IFeatureClass;
struct __declspec(uuid("1afcdb31-ac09-11d2-8a1e-006097aff44e"))
/* interface */ IObjectClass;
struct __declspec(uuid("22b00697-8895-11d2-8a0d-006097aff44e"))
/* interface */ IEnumRelationshipClass;
struct __declspec(uuid("22b00693-8895-11d2-8a0d-006097aff44e"))
/* interface */ IRelationshipClass;
struct __declspec(uuid("d4803ee3-79f4-11d0-97fc-0080c7f79481"))
/* interface */ IFeatureDataset;
struct __declspec(uuid("1afcdb34-ac09-11d2-8a1e-006097aff44e"))
/* interface */ IObject;
struct __declspec(uuid("22b00696-8895-11d2-8a0d-006097aff44e"))
/* interface */ IRelationship;
struct __declspec(uuid("22b00695-8895-11d2-8a0d-006097aff44e"))
/* interface */ IEnumRelationship;
struct __declspec(uuid("a53a808e-13c4-11d3-a0de-0000f8775bf9"))
/* interface */ IRelClassEnumRowPairs;
struct __declspec(uuid("76f9849e-84c3-11d2-ab61-000000000000"))
/* interface */ IEnumRule;
struct __declspec(uuid("236f4de4-4761-11d2-9932-0000f80372b4"))
/* interface */ IRule;
struct __declspec(uuid("d4803ee9-79f4-11d0-97fc-0080c7f79481"))
/* interface */ IFeature;
struct __declspec(uuid("d4803ef8-79f4-11d0-97fc-0080c7f79481"))
/* interface */ IFeatureCursor;
struct __declspec(uuid("956a4e53-2482-11d1-89d8-006097aff44e"))
/* interface */ IFeatureBuffer;
struct __declspec(uuid("97103d51-3a9e-11d1-8816-0000f877762d"))
/* interface */ IQueryDef;
struct __declspec(uuid("ff866b9f-6f94-11d3-80e5-00c04f686238"))
/* interface */ IFeatureWorkspaceManage;
struct __declspec(uuid("74996427-6627-11d3-80d3-00c04f686238"))
/* interface */ IFeatureWorkspaceSchemaEdit;
struct __declspec(uuid("fe8f2fec-85ae-11d4-a0ca-00c04f6bdd84"))
/* interface */ IGeodatabaseRelease;
struct __declspec(uuid("d80957f0-8883-11d2-aabb-00c04fa37b82"))
/* interface */ IWorkspaceDomains;
struct __declspec(uuid("8917197e-8884-11d2-aabb-00c04fa37b82"))
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-